What laser power range is presented on the market now The laser power range available on the market varies greatly, depending on the type of laser and its application. The laser power range starts as low as a few milliwatts for laser pointers and bar-code scanners, and go up to many kilowatts for industrial cutting and welding machines. 1. Diode lasers: The power range of diode lasers is typically in the range of a few milliwatts to several watts. 2. Solid-state lasers: The power range of solid-state lasers varies from a few watts to kilowatts. 3. Fiber lasers: The power range of fiber lasers is typically in the range of a few watts to kilowatts. 4. Gas lasers: The power range of gas lasers varies from a few watts to several kilowatts. 5. Liquid lasers: The power range of liquid lasers varies from a few milliwatts to several hundred watts. The exact power range of a laser system depends on its design, the materials used, and the cooling and pumping methods. The laser power range should be chosen based on the specific application requirements, including the material properties and the processing speed desired.

I’d like to know about lasers A laser is a device that produces a beam of light through a process called stimulated emission. The light produced by a laser is unique in that it is very intense, highly collimated (meaning it forms a tight beam), and is of a single, narrow frequency (or color). Lasers have many applications. They can cut and weld materials, read and write data on CDs and DVDs, measure distances. They are indispensable in some medical procedures, such as eye surgery. The word “laser” is an acronym for “light amplification by stimulated emission of radiation.”
Where semiconductor lasers are being used Semiconductor lasers, also known as laser diodes, have a wide range of applications. They are used for: 1. Data storage: in CD, DVD, and Blu-ray players for reading and writing data on optical discs. 2. Optical communication: in fiber optic communication systems for transmitting information over long distances. 3. Bar-code scanning: in bar-code scanners for reading bar codes in retail and other industries. 4. Printing and imaging: in laser printers and copiers for printing and copying documents and images. 5. Medicine: in ophthalmology, dermatology, cosmetology for hair removal, skin resurfacing, and other cosmetic procedures. 6. Military and defense: in range-finding and targeting systems. 7. Industrial processing: for cutting, welding, marking, and engraving various materials in the manufacturing industry. Semiconductor lasers are ideal for these applications due to their small sizes, low power consumption, and high efficiency.

Tell us more about energy, pulse width and pulse duration for lasers Energy, pulse width, and pulse duration are important parameters for characterizing laser performance. 1. Energy: The energy of a laser pulse is the amount of energy delivered by the laser in a single pulse. The energy of a laser pulse is typically measured in joules (J). High energy laser pulses can be used for cutting and welding, while low energy laser pulses are used for applications in spectroscopy and marking. 2. Pulse width: The laser pulse width is the duration of a single laser pulse. The pulse width is typically measured in nanoseconds (ns) or picoseconds (ps). The pulse width can range from a few nanoseconds to several microseconds, depending on the application and the type of laser used. 3. Pulse duration: The laser pulse duration is the total time that the laser emits light in a single pulse. This is different from the pulse width, which is the duration of the light output at its peak. The laser pulse duration can be much longer than the pulse width and is typically measured in nanoseconds or microseconds. The selection of the appropriate laser parameters, including energy, pulse width, and pulse duration, depends on the specific application and the properties of the material being processed. The laser energy, pulse width, and pulse duration should be optimized to achieve the desired processing results while minimizing damage to the material or surrounding environment.

The difference between these 2 types of lenses is the focal range. A 3 element lens can have the focus range of 2-10 cm while the focal range of the G2 lens is 2-10 mm (10 times less than the 3 element lens focal range).
Cooling of the laser diodes is very important. The cooler the module the longer the lifetime of the laser, the higher the laser power.

What is the application of liquid lasers Liquid lasers, also known as dye lasers, have several applications, including: 1. Scientific research: e.g., in spectroscopy, interferometry, and laser cooling experiments in physics and chemistry. 2. Medicine: in dermatology, ophthalmology, dentistry, and cosmetology for tattoo removal, skin resurfacing. 3. Printing and imaging: such as digital light processing (DLP) and laser displays. 4. Entertainment: in laser light shows, where they produce bright, colorful beams of light. 5. Art and design: in artistic installations and for laser engraving and cutting. Unique properties of liquid lasers, such as tunable wavelengths, high brightness, and short pulse duration make them ideal for these applications. However, they also have some drawbacks, such as the need for continuous cooling, special handling and storage of the laser dyes.

Every type of diode needs its type of driver. For example, the driver from NUBM44 or NUBM47 will not work for the M140 diode. A high-quality laser driver can stabilize current and maintain constant values of the current and voltage going directly to the diode.

A fiber laser is very powerful and a standard industrial fiber laser will have a significantly longer life span than other types of Co2 and diode lasers. The Fiber laser will permanently engrave on metals that other lasers cannot such as stainless steel, titanium, copper, aluminum, and other metals. On a Co2 laser, cutting is better on a wide application of materials over a fiber laser however engraving on metals requires expensive CO2 lasers. Controlling the diode laser temperature is very important. The diode laser wavelength is also strongly influenced by temperature and the wavelength of the diode laser is affected by the driving current. Therefore, the varied power of the diode can cause a varying laser wavelength. High power usage for endurance lasers is at 70 degrees Celsius. What happens during high temperature is high power consumption and the temperature goes up, while laser power goes down. A laser diode’s maximum operating temperature is 70 degrees Celsius. Do not run at 70, but instead run at a maximum temperature of 60 degrees Celsius or below to prevent power loss during continuous usage.
